#b3ecff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3ecff is composed of 70.2% red, 92.5%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.8% cyan, 7.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 195 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 85.1%. #b3ecff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#67d9ff.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#b3ecff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3ecff has RGB values of R:179, G:236,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 11791615.

Shades and Tints of #b3ecff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#eefb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b3ecff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d6dadc is the less saturated color, while #b3ecff is the most saturated one.
